2015

Members of the Columbus Chamber Ambassadors, Chamber Action Team and Chamber staff attended a ribbon cutting ceremony at Popportunity, a specialty popcorn shop. Owners Laurie Booher and Tony London, along with Booher’s son, Collin, cut the ribbon.

2000

Edinburgh High School senior Lydia Storie was selected to participate in the International finals of McDonald’s All American Crew Competition on Oct. 28 in Chicago. Storie was among 15 of the 130,000 McDonald’s employees in the Great Lakes Region who qualified for the event.

1975

Edwin Booth of Columbus was named the executive director of the Cummins Engine Foundation, and replaced James Joseph. Booth was previously associate director of the Irwin-Sweeney-Miller Foundation.
